Web18 mei 2024 · milk of magnesia, common name for the chemical compound magnesium hydroxide, Mg(OH)2. The viscous, white, mildly alkaline mixture that is used medicinally as an antacid and laxative is a suspension of approximately 8% magnesium hydroxide in water. Web1 apr. 2024 · Stimulants—Stimulant laxatives, also known as contact laxatives, encourage bowel movements by acting on the intestinal wall. They increase the muscle contractions that move along the stool mass. Stimulant laxatives are a popular type of laxative for self-treatment. However, they also are more likely to cause side effects.

Web14 nov. 2024 · When it comes to pregnancy, there are many over-the-counter medications that are off-limits.But, the good news is that for most pregnant women, milk of magnesia … WebLAXATIVE: Adults: 2 to 4 tablespoonfuls (30-60 mL). Children 6 to 12 years: 1 to 2 tablespoonfuls (15-30 mL). Children 2 to 6 years: 1 teaspoonful to 1 tablespoonful (5-15 mL). Children under 2 years: Consult a physician.

Magnesia is valuable because it is both a poor electrical conductor and an excellent thermal conductor.
